About 43 Wind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

43 Wind Street is a mid-terrace house in Swansea (SA1 1EF). It has a recorded floor area of 45 m² (around 484 sq ft) and construction records dating it to before 1900. At 45 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across the building (45–77 m²). The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the bottom. On EPC score it ranks last in the building (48 versus a best of 80). The latest certificate (December 2025) shows an E (score 48),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it C (March 2012); the latest reading is 2 bands lower.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and hot-water ef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or. Main heating runs on electricity. This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.

It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 88% of similar EPCs). Last sold in April 2015, so it's been off the market for around 11 years. 4 planning records sit against the property, 4 approved, 0 refused.
